## Alert: StatRelay Sidecar Flush Lag

This alert fires when the StatRelay metrics-aggregation sidecar falls more than 120 seconds behind on flushing buffered samples to the Coalmine backend. Plugin-emitted counters are buffered in-process, so sustained lag usually means a plugin is emitting unbounded label cardinality or blocking the flush thread. Check your plugin's metric registration against the published cardinality limits before escalating. If the lag persists after your plugin is ruled out, contact the telemetry team.

escalation mailbox, bagug-fahof: novdor.wendor.jormir@norvalabs.example

# Bouncewright — email bounce processor env file.
# This service polls the Merrow mail relay for bounce notifications,
# classifies them (hard, soft, complaint), and updates suppression lists
# in the Haldane contact store. Parsing runs locally; no message bodies
# are retained past classification. Non-secret tuning values are below.
# The credential Bouncewright uses to authenticate to the Merrow relay
# is set on the next line:

env line for fafof-fahag: LEDGER_TOKEN5=f8790

Onboarding note: GarageSense occupancy feed. Support owns triage for feed gaps. Feed pushes stall counts from the Delmere garages every 30 seconds; a gap over five minutes pages on-call. Check the ingest dashboard first, then the gateway logs. Don't restart the collector without on-call approval. If the collector's recovery console prompts you, it expects the recovery passphrase noted below.

unlock words, kajeg-fahif: holmir-casael-novdor

## Environments — Murkwater DNS quirks

So, plugin authors keep hitting the flaky DNS thing in our sandbox environment. Short version: the sandbox resolver occasionally times out on first lookup, and your plugin should retry once before declaring the Murkwater API unreachable. Prod doesn't have this problem. If you want to reproduce locally, point your resolver at the sandbox settings we run, which are captured below.

service settings:
PRAWYN_PIN=9848
PRAWYN_METRICS_HOST=metrics.prawyn.lumicworks.corp
PRAWYN_LOG_LEVEL=warn
PRAWYN_TENANT=pelius